3 Advantages Of Using Gamified Form Of Learning

Playing games is a fun way of learning. While some students get public relations assignment writing help and hire tutors, others use gamified modes of learning and enjoy studying.

If the concept of gamified learning is weird to you, then here are some advantages for you:

1) Keeps one excited to learn

One of the biggest reasons students dislike reading is that they do not feel motivated to do so. But when you blend studying with playing games, students are more eager to learn. Students can use and play logic games, puzzle games, and more.

3) Skill development

You might be wrong if you thought that game was only for having fun and playing. You can develop a lot of skills by playing games. Logical thinking skills, teamwork, critical thinking abilities, leadership and team management are some of them.
